We are fairly new residents in Henderson, NV. We went to Ruth's Chris in Las Vegas for my birthday last night because I love crab cakes and I had the best crab cakes ever in the Ruth's Chris in Baton Rouge. We had the crab cake app and I ordered the BBQ Shrimp which I also loved in Baton Rouge.
The crab cakes were served with very visible brown or burned edges on the top. They tasted more like burned toast than crab cakes. This made me look at the bottom of the cake and it was black. Nearly $40 wasted. The BBQ shrimp amounted to what may as well have been frozen cooked and peeled shrimp arranged in a mound of mashed potatoes, with a yellow sauce on top. Certainly nothing like Baton Rouge, even though it is still Ruth's Chris. $48 wasted.
This restaurant is very busy and very noisy. We had window seating and could only see the entrance to Harrah's and the LINQ. Certainly not worth the $10 per person charge for sitting at the window.
We will not be back, and probably will not go for a nice meal anywhere on the strip. Everything is very expensive and geared to large scale production. Add parking charges on top of the expensive, mediocre food and it is a failure.
